Partnership Agreements
Sage has developed partnership agreements with the following 4-year colleges to guarantee admission to the Sage graduate program in Occupational Therapy for qualified students. These agreements provide for:
- Automatic acceptance into the Occupational Therapy Program for students who have completed OT Program course prerequisites, after initial advisement and interview, and with completed applicaiton;
- Waiver of Sage Graduate School application fee;
- Early acceptance (for students who submit applications prior to October 15 of their senior year);
- Advisement to coordinate undergraduate electives and coursework to address OT Program prerequisites; and
- Opportunity to apply early for graduate assistantships.
Qualified students will:
- Earn a baccalaureate degree prior to entering the MS in OT Program;
- Maintain a minimum overall 3.0 GPA in their undergraduate programs and OT Program prerequisite courses;
- Complete an admission interview with OT Program faculty; and
- Document completion of clinical observation hours under the supervision of an occupational therapist.
